Subject: Door sensor recall — Hollybank site

Hello and welcome,

The motion sensors on the east wing doors are being recalled by the supplier and will be offline this week. Those doors won't open automatically, so please use the manual keypad beside each frame instead. Hold the door for no one you don't recognise. The keypad accepts the temporary code below.

door code, kawip-bagap: bdg-HQEWH-4

Account recovery during the Tannerhill queue migration: while the legacy `jobloom` queue is being replaced by Ferrocast, recovery jobs may land in either system. Check both dashboards before re-issuing. Re-run `recover_account --replay` only once per user. The replay tool unlocks with the maintainer recovery passphrase, recorded immediately below for future maintainers.

strongbox words: fraath-isteth

Hey, welcome aboard! Quick heads-up on the fun one: we're mid-hunt on a file descriptor leak in the Copperfin ingest workers. Symptoms are slow creep in open FDs over ~12 hours, then sudden connection refusals. If you get paged, just recycle the affected worker pool — that buys us a day. Notes, lsof snippets, and the suspect-commit list are all on the page below.

operations page: https://rundeck.ferradata.local/issue/dash/merge_requests/secrets/d01946f423debaa0